Low carbon arable production - FREE event, Wiltshire
05 August 2011
An afternoon seminar session will be held in Yatesbury, Wiltshire on Friday 23 September, looking into low carbon farming practices in relation to arable production. Expert speakers will talk about the importance of soil management to reduce nitrous oxide emissions and increase carbon sequestration and practical measures that can be implemented to reduce a farms carbon footprint. We'll also hear Hugo House from Good Energy talk about on-farm renewable energy opportunities. The afternoon talks will be followed by a farm tour, seeing low carbon arable production in practice and an evening buffet supper.
